[jboss-cvs] JBossAS SVN: r68584 - trunk/jmx/src/main/org/jboss/mx/loading.
jboss-cvs-commits at lists.jboss.org
jboss-cvs-commits at lists.jboss.org
Sun Dec 30 20:54:21 EST 2007
Author: scott.stark at jboss.org
Date: 2007-12-30 20:54:21 -0500 (Sun, 30 Dec 2007)
New Revision: 68584
Modified:
trunk/jmx/src/main/org/jboss/mx/loading/LoadMgr3.java
trunk/jmx/src/main/org/jboss/mx/loading/UnifiedLoaderRepository3.java
Log:
Add more trace logging about why a class loader indexed by package cannot find a class.
Modified: trunk/jmx/src/main/org/jboss/mx/loading/LoadMgr3.java
===================================================================
--- trunk/jmx/src/main/org/jboss/mx/loading/LoadMgr3.java 2007-12-30 22:30:22 UTC (rev 68583)
+++ trunk/jmx/src/main/org/jboss/mx/loading/LoadMgr3.java 2007-12-31 01:54:21 UTC (rev 68584)
@@ -272,6 +272,13 @@
theUCL = ucl;
order = uclOrder;
}
+ else if(trace)
+ {
+ if(url == null)
+ log.trace("No resource found for: "+classRsrcName);
+ else
+ log.trace("Ignoring class loader based on order: "+ucl);
+ }
}
if( theUCL == null && task.stopOrder == Integer.MAX_VALUE)
{
Modified: trunk/jmx/src/main/org/jboss/mx/loading/UnifiedLoaderRepository3.java
===================================================================
--- trunk/jmx/src/main/org/jboss/mx/loading/UnifiedLoaderRepository3.java 2007-12-30 22:30:22 UTC (rev 68583)
+++ trunk/jmx/src/main/org/jboss/mx/loading/UnifiedLoaderRepository3.java 2007-12-31 01:54:21 UTC (rev 68584)
@@ -321,6 +321,8 @@
catch (ClassNotFoundException x)
{
// The class is not visible by the calling classloader
+ if(log.isTraceEnabled())
+ log.trace("Failed to load class: "+name, x);
}
return null;
}
More information about the jboss-cvs-commits
mailing list